On 09.03.2020 16:07, Tamas K Lengyel wrote: > On Mon, Mar 9, 2020 at 5:49 AM Jan Beulich <jbeulich@xxxxxxxx> wrote: >> >> The common header doesn't itself need to include public/vm_event.h nor >> public/memory.h. Drop their inclusion. This requires using the non- >> typedef names in two prototypes and an inline function; by not changing >> the callers and function definitions at the same time it'll remain >> certain that the build would fail if the typedef itself was changed. > > Just curious, what's the benefit of doing this? Less dependencies that (almost) every CU gets, and hence statistically less rebuilds of (almost) everything when only a rather special purpose header file changes.
